2012-09-16 10 views
6

मेरे पास एक ओपन सोर्स प्लगइन है, एक लाइसेंस के साथ जो मुझे इसे संशोधित करने की अनुमति देता है, यहां से: http://www.jcraft.com/eclipse-jcterm/ (स्रोत अनुभाग के अंतर्गत)। मैं इस प्लगइन को संशोधित करना चाहता हूं और इसे अपने स्थानीय ग्रहण पर उपयोग करना चाहता हूं।मौजूदा ग्रहण प्लगइन को कैसे संपादित करें?

  1. क्या यह मेरे पास जार फ़ाइल भी संभव है? या मुझे और चाहिए?
  2. ग्रहण में इसे लाने के लिए मुझे क्या करना चाहिए (स्पष्ट रूप से एक्लिप्स प्लगइन विकास दृश्य के माध्यम से)?
  3. मैं यह प्लगइन कैसे स्थापित कर सकता हूं यह सत्यापित करने के लिए मैं इसे कैसे स्थापित कर सकता हूं?

उत्तर

2
  1. कहीं भी प्लग-इन JAR डाउनलोड करें।
  2. ग्रहण, फ़ाइल> आयात> प्लग-इन और टुकड़े
  3. में
  4. निर्देशिका आप में यह बचाया का चयन करें, 'परियोजनाओं स्रोत फ़ोल्डर के साथ', अगला
  5. प्लगइन जोड़ें, समाप्त
चयन

अब आपके पास प्लगइन का प्रतिनिधित्व करने वाला एक ग्रहण परियोजना है। अपने परिवर्तन करें, और उसके बाद:

  1. फ़ाइल> निर्यात> Deployable प्लग इन और टुकड़े
  2. , प्लग-इन का चयन करें इसे सहेजने के लिए

मैं नहीं एक जगह का चयन आईडीई के आपके उदाहरण में 'लाइव' प्लग-इन पर विकास करने के तरीके के बारे में जानें, इसलिए मुझे लगता है कि आपको इसे प्लगइन निर्देशिका में छोड़कर ग्रहण की अपनी प्रतिलिपि में इंस्टॉल करना होगा, फिर पुनरारंभ करें।

+0

निर्भरताओं के बारे में क्या? जब मैं प्लगइन निर्यात करता हूं तो मेरे पास निर्भर जार फ़ाइलों को बंडल नहीं किया जाता है। – Zombies

+0

@ ज़ोंबी मुझे मूल प्लगइन में कोई भी निर्भर जेएआर नहीं दिख रहा है, तो यह एक नया जार है कि आप सही जोड़ रहे हैं? आपको निर्भरता के बारे में प्लगइन बताना होगा। उदाहरण के लिए पहले एक lib फ़ोल्डर में परियोजना में JAR (ओं) जोड़ें। फिर, plugin.xml रनटाइम टैब पर जाएं, और उन्हें प्लगइन मेनिफेस्ट में जोड़ें। जब आप प्लगइन निर्यात करते हैं, तो उस फ़ोल्डर और उसके सामग्रियों को शामिल करना चाहिए, साथ ही साथ उन्हें लेबलपैड में शामिल करना चाहिए जब प्लगइन लोड हो और निष्पादित हो। – sharakan

+0

@ ज़ोंबी ने आपके लिए यह काम किया? – sharakan

0

ग्रहण विकास के लिए ग्रहण का विशेष वातावरण है: PDE। एक सरल प्लगइन विकसित करने के तरीके पर tutorial है।

मुझे लगता है कि this instruction काफी प्रासंगिक है, यह बताता है कि पीईडीवी में योगदान कैसे शुरू करें और पर्यावरण को कैसे स्थापित करें इस पर एक स्पष्टीकरण के साथ शुरू होता है।

संबंधित मुद्दे